Application: Upstream Approaches to Canadian Population Health

Although Canada is contiguous to the United States and has some cultural and historical similarities, Canada’s population enjoys a vastly superior health status. Reasons are many, can be traced historically, and are related to a different view of the role of government. The experience of Canada demonstrates that neither a heterogeneous population, nor a health system that has waiting lines for services, are reasons for poor health. By looking critically at what produces good health in Canada, much can be learned about steps the U.S. might need to take if population health is its goal.
